Alo Apartments
Apartment complex
About
Inspired by the beauty of Buffalo Lake, Alo Apartments brings a wave of luxury to affordable living in Buffalo, Minnesota. The 60-unit community offers a mix of studio, one, two, and three-bedroom apartment homes and abundant amenities.The property's ideal location along 1st Avenue NW between 2nd and 3rd Street NW allows residents to enjoy an easy stroll to picturesque Buffalo Lake.
Business Hours
Monday
9:00 AM - 5:00 PM
Tuesday
9:00 AM - 5:00 PM
Wednesday
9:00 AM - 5:00 PM
Thursday
9:00 AM - 5:00 PM
Friday
9:00 AM - 5:00 PM
Saturday
Closed
Sunday
Closed
Customer Reviews
No reviews yet. Be the first to review!